The Ghana Water Company Limited (GWL) has announced the appointment of Adam Mutawakilu as the Acting Managing Director.
The former Damongo MP's appointment, made by President John Mahama, aligns with Article 195(1) of the 1992 Constitution and is pending approval by the Board in consultation with the Public Services Commission.
In his first address to GWL staff, Mr Mutawakilu expressed gratitude for the opportunity and pledged to work collaboratively with all stakeholders to enhance the company's operations.

He highlighted GWL’s critical role in ensuring quality, continuous, and uninterrupted water supply, particularly to underserved communities.
“I may not have an extensive background in water management, but I bring experience in energy, finance, and governance, and I am eager to learn from and work with the dedicated professionals at Ghana Water Limited,” he stated.
Mr Mutawakilu holds an MSc in Development Finance from the University of Ghana, an MSc in Energy Economics from the Ghana Institute of Management and Public Administration (GIMPA), and pursued an MPhil in Petroleum and Oil Studies at the University of Cape Coast. He also has a Commonwealth Executive Master’s in Business Administration from KNUST and an Executive Certificate in Governance and Leadership from the Ghana School of Governance and Leadership.

His professional experience includes serving as the first Member of Parliament for Damongo Constituency (2013–2020), Ranking Member of the Mines and Energy Committee in Parliament, District Chief Executive for West Gonja District, and Head of Treasury at the University for Development Studies (UDS) Central Administration.
